An elegant dance of colourful accents has been choreographed through these four stylish home interiors, creating uplifting moments that are harmonious with a neutral stage. White and natural wood tone provide a clean modern base for brighter accents, whilst black elements instill weight and confidence. Modern furniture and contemporary textiles build layers of simple comfort that appear effortless and homey. Being realistically proportioned, this collection of home designs supply practical decor and layout inspiration for the standard home: Find welcoming living room designs with flair, inspiration for attractive room dividers, creative use of space in kitchen and dining areas, cosy bedroom ideas and striking compact bathroom designs.

Inspired by a real world apartment in St Petersburg Russia by Cartelle Design , this visualisation features the same beautifully tall ceilings and large windows that flood the original room with bright daylight. Also present are the Georgian coving and panel moulding, though a brighter and warmer colour palette changes the interior character of the space now.

A grey rug pools cooler colour under a rich brown leather sofa.

Blue and green infusions are replaced by muted red clay accents in our second interior design. Scatter cushions and a matching throw splash colour onto a comfortable modern sofa .

A large ottoman makes the modern sofa into a flexible L-shaped arrangement, which can be shuffled over to make extra dining space when friends come around.

A long TV stand stretches the full width of the living room dining room combo , spreading a grey and timber accent as it goes.

Beautifully light reflective orb dining room pendant lights float like weightless bubbles above a small dining table with a simple glass vase centrepiece.

A sleek black linear suspension light strikes a more minimalist style aesthetic in the nearby kitchen.

A basic dining peninsula effectively divides the kitchen from the lounge.

White wall cabinets help the narrow galley kitchen to feel open and spacious.

A blast of bright yellow greets us in home number three. Unusual modern wall sconces add a palm fuelled tropical vibe.

A brown leather pouf makes a warm colour match with the modern lounge chair , which carries an easy deckchair silhouette. Blue artwork and a matching blue floor lamp put a summer sky above it.

The summery room is cooled by a large ceiling fan with light . A contemporary slatted room divider lets the breeze flow right through.

A built-in bookcase creates a second ventilated room divider behind the couch. indoor herb planters make a revitalising addition to the decor.

The custom bookcase allows the lounge, kitchen and dining area to feel interconnected whilst setting a clear boundary.

The wooden dining table is a slightly darker tone to the kitchen and the flooring, which gives it its own identity in the open space. A mature indoor plant fills the corner of the room with lush greenery.

Black, grey and shades of earthy brown decorate the suave interiors of three 60 square metre modern apartments. The tonal combination paints decor schemes that are smoothly understated, whilst exuding utmost confidence and style. We’ll take a tour of a contemporary apartment that’s framed with decorative black and white boiserie for a high contrast neoclassical aesthetic. We’ll explore the small separate spaces of a home with chic space conscious solutions, and a sharp little bathroom composition. Finally, we’ll round things off with an impressive apartment design that’s expertly conquered the quirky shape of its angular architecture and some less than ideal window placements.

Our first 60 square metre apartment is located in Chisinau, Moldova. A cushiony grey modular sofa and silver grey rug mark out a lounge area in the home’s open plan living space.

A rustic coffee table adds a wonderfully textured warm accent to the middle of the lounge, which ties in with a wood tone breakfast bar that stands behind the couch.

Timber planks make an attractive feature over the TV wall, where a floating media unit adds a crisp white accent. Mature indoor plants complement the natural wood grain elements, and add height to the room.

A modern plant stand makes a chic addition to a wall of decorative boiserie beside the kitchen diner.

Gold elements add beautiful lustre to a black linear suspension light over the dining peninsula, which doubles as a bar.

Boiserie gets a high contrast two-tone treatment inside of the master bedroom. Black bedroom pendant lights meld moodily with the darker side of the room. The black designer table lamp over in the lighter half is the Atollo lamp . Slatted wardrobe doors leak ambient light into the black and white bedroom .

Heavy grey drapes frame the bedroom window, where sheer white drapes provide privacy.

Luxurious marble tiles make up a black and white bathroom scheme.

This 60 square metre floor plan in Lviv, Ukraine is split into separate compact living spaces. A small sofa fits snugly into the neat lounge room, where panel molding frames out the wall. A large piece of wall art plays with the room’s proportions.

A round coffee table adds a lighter shade of grey, and the area rug goes lighter still to create tonal layers.

On the opposite side of the room, a black floating TV stand contrasts with pale paintwork.

A black glass vase adds a small decorative element to the minimalist arrangement.

The remainder of the small lounge area is dedicated to a vanity table and chair , which becomes an independent space behind a bookcase room divider. An illuminated vanity mirror brightens the nook.

A wine storage case makes a slick backlit design feature in the kitchen, surrounded by chocolatey wood tone.

A modern dining chandelier throws black arcs against a ribbed gypsum wall panel.

The extendable dining table provides a flexible solution for the small space.

Warm grey and wood grain cabinets make up a smooth one wall kitchen arrangement, which is sliced through with a glossy black marble backsplash.

In the bedroom, a grey platform bed adds weight to a predominantly creamy white scheme. A black bedroom pendant light makes a slender addition to one side of the platform bed , whilst a floating dressing table occupies the other.

The glass closet helps the room feel larger, and its light boxes supply extra lighting.

Track lights and recessed perimeter lighting is used throughout the home.

Custom closets have been made fit floor-to-ceiling in the hallway of the apartment.

A small entryway seat pulls up at the hallway shelf. Coat hooks have been applied to a smart inlay of rich wood slats.

The sharp rectangular bathroom sink complements a linear bathroom vanity design with a floating storage volume underneath. An illuminated vanity mirror burns against wood effect tile.

A built-in bathtub and square toilet continue the sharp aesthetic.

In the shower room, a contemporary bathroom vanity light spotlights the same sink and toilet models.

Black bathroom fixtures contrast deeply with a grey stone wet zone.

Our final 60 square metre home features an open and airy layout with a glass wall bedroom design. The transparent feature really expands the feel of the place, and allows shared daylight from tucked away windows.

The unusual shape of the home has been harnessed as a design positive rather than a hindrance. To combat the grey living room ’s angular form, rounded corners ensure that furniture flows easily into the narrowing space.

A TV wall unit floats as one self-contained piece. A deep frame surrounds a wooden TV mounting panel, and cradles a modern media unit.

The TV ‘cube’ wraps around the corner to become one wall of the L-shaped kitchen design.

Red kitchen bar stools line up along an island to shake up the neutral decor palette.

A black swing arm wall lamp shines double lamp heads over the couch.

Made-to-measure wardrobes line the hallway with oodles of storage space.

In the master bedroom, a platformed floor makes a unique floating feature of the bed.

Chocolate milk curtains sweeten the grey bedroom scheme, and make a perfect tonal match with wood effect wardrobes.

A freestanding TV mount addresses the lack of TV wall space in the glass wall bedroom.

At the end of the hallway, mirrored closet doors create the illusion of added length and natural light.

In the bathroom, a frameless shower screen has been cut to fit around a unique bathroom sink , creating a slick custom finish.
Dark isn’t the first theme that comes to mind when designing a kitchen. Stereotypical assumptions are of white and bright kitchens matched by light wood—something like the color of breakfast pancakes. Have you ever thought otherwise? Perhaps something like a modern dark kitchen?
We’ve got a collection of stunning spaces sure to switch up your vision. This black kitchen design inspiration is the sexiest interior design can muster. All divulging in shades of black, navy, or dark brown, they add what white kitchens cannot—a seductive allure that says sleekness and sophistication at the same time. Take a peek at some brilliant interiors on the darker side to see if a modern luxury black kitchen could be for you.
